摘要
It is controversial whether a European monetary union strengthens or weakens member governments' incentives to adopt "reasonable" fiscal policies. But what is "fiscal discipline"? Can we specify a Community-wide fiscal policy? This report deals with the monetary union existence itself which causes compromise acceptance by national governments in setting their own fiscal policies. The report also talks about possibilities to specify certain fiscal discipline rules and the tools for this created. Fiscal policy discipline under the monetary union may require a member country to adopt a policy that is sub-optimal from its own viewpoint. It is very demanding to meet increased fiscal policy coordination and implement it in practise; however, it is inevitable to search for other possible alternatives that would preserve governments' decision independence in their own fiscal policies.
